Christmas Day
A German and Slavic diminutive of Natalia, which ultimately derives from the Latin phrase 'dies natalis' meaning 'birthday'. Historically, the name was given to girls born on or around Christmas Day.
Less common today
Natascha isn't in the latest US Top 1000. It last peaked at #3,572 in 1990.
